Elliotts is a small and friendly caravan park situated on Hayling Island, a short walk from the beach.
The holiday caravans are arranged in an unusual cross formation, each having their own garden which can be fenced to contain any little children or a dog. Due to the layout, caravan sizes are restricted, but this is reflected in the prices and means you can buy a holiday home on the south coast, minutes from the beach, for a very reasonable price. We also have three caravans for hire.
On site facilities include a social club, laundry and recreation field.
Hayling Island is a traditional and popular seaside holiday destination with award winning beaches and excellent sporting and leisure facilities. The island’s miles of unspoilt coastline and countryside offer a haven of peace and tranquility, and are ideal for walking, cycling and relaxing.

Things To Do
Elliotts caravan site is located on Hayling Island, on the south coast between Portsmouth and Chichester, and there is lots to do in the area.
Towns – Picturesque local towns include Emsworth, Bosham, Chichester, and East Meon. There is a good selection of shops at Havant and Portsmouth including the Gunwharf Quays shopping outlet and Spinnaker Tower.
Stately Homes & Gardens – Stansted Park, Uppark House & Gardens, Hinton Ampner, Petworth House & Gardens, Avington Park, West Dean Gardens, Arundel Castle, Staunton Country Park.
Museums – Portsmouth has an interesting selection of museums which include the Portsmouth Historic Dockyard where you can visit Nelson’s Victory and the Mary Rose, as well as the Cumberland House Natural History Museum, D-Day Story Museum, Southsea Castle, Genesis Expo, the Portsmouth Museum, and the Charles Dickens Birthplace Museum. Other sites of interest include Fishbourne Roman Palace, the Beaulieu Motor Museum, Weald & Downland Living Museum, Tangmere Military & Aviation Museum, Gosport Submarine Museum, Little Woodham Living History Village.
Nature – Arundel Wetland Centre is great for birdwatchers as is the Titchfield Haven nature reserve at Gosport. Kingley Vale ancient yew forest. Queen Elizabeth Country Park. Marwell Zoo.
Entertainment – On Hayling Island there is Funland and the Hayling Seaside Railway. At Southsea there is the Clarence Pier amusement park and Treasure Island Adventure Golf. There are cinemas in Port Solent, Portsmouth and Chichester. There are theatres in Portsmouth and Chichester.


Eating & Drinking – There are several restaurants located within walking distance of the park including the Drift Bar at Sparkes Marina. There is a variety of old pubs and restaurants on Hayling Island, and at Emsworth, Portsmouth and the Gun Wharf Quays.
Activities – There are a lot of great coastal walks in the area. The Billy Trail is a 9.8 mile walking and cycling path that runs from Havant Train Station almost to the southern end of the island. There are three long distance walking routes that start at Emsworth – the Solent Way, the Wayfairers Walk and the Sussex Border Path. Inland you can walk on the South Downs National Park or cycle the Meon Valley Trail from Wickham to West Meon. You can play golf on the island at the Tournerbury Golf Centre or the Hayling Island Golf Club. Horse riding at Pook Lane Stables at Havant. Outdoor swimming on the 3 miles of beaches on the island. Indoor swimming at the Havant Leisure Centre. Sailing at one of the 3 sailing clubs on the island – Hayling Ferry, Mengeham Rythe and Hayling Island Sailing Club.
Events – This part of the south coast is particularly blessed with events. There is horse racing at Goodwood (Glorious Goodwood in July) and Fontwell, motor racing at the Goodwood Revival and Festival of Speed, polo at Cowdray Park near Midhurst, sailing and yachting in the harbour culminating with the Isle of Wight Cowes Week. The Portsmouth Kite Festival takes place on Southsea Common in August.
